price $1 200 000 USD engine Porsche Watercooled Flat-6 position Mid Longitudinal aspiration Twin KKK turbochargers valvetrain Quad Cam, 4 Valves / Cyl fuel feed TAG Mototronic Fuel Injection displacement 2994 cc / 182.7 cu in bore 95.0 mm / 3.74 in stroke 70.4 mm / 2.77 in compression 9.0:1 power 544.4 kw / 730.0 bhp @ 7400 rpm hp per litre 243.82 bhp per litre bhp/weight 708.74 bhp per weight torque 700.9 nm / 517.0 ft lbs @ 5000 rpm redline 7800 drive wheels RWD w/Limited Slip Differential body / frame Carbon Fibre / Kevlar front brakes Brembro Ventilated Discs w/4-Piston Calipers f brake size 330 mm / 13.0 in rear brakes Brembro Ventilated Discs w/4-Piston Calipers r brake size 330 mm / 13.0 in front wheels F 45.7 x 26.7 cm / 18 x 10.5 in rear wheels R 45.7 x 33.0 cm / 18.0 x 13 in front tire size 285/30ZR-18 rear tire size 345/35ZR-18 f suspension Double Wishbones w/Adj Anti-Roll Bars, Spring/Damper Units r suspension Double Inverted Wishbones w/Radius Rods, Adj Anti-Roll Bars, Spring/Damper Units weight 1030 kg / 2271 lbs length 4650 mm / 183.1 in width 1985 mm / 78.1 in height 1050 mm / 41.3 in transmission Porsche 5-Speed Manual w/Tiptronic Control, Hydraulic Sinter Clutch top speed 404.6 kph / 251.4 mph 0 - 60 mph 2.6 seconds drag 0.31Cd Supercar Spotlight from *************
